Handover note — Crumbwheel order cutoffs.

Welcome aboard. The bakery cutoff rule in Crumbwheel closes same-day orders at 14:00 local to each storefront, not UTC — this has bitten us twice. Holiday overrides live in the calendar service and take precedence silently, so always check there first when a cutoff looks wrong. To unlock the calendar service's admin console after a restart, enter the recovery passphrase below.

vault phrase of bagap-bahaf = silion-pelox-sorox-casdor-quenwyn-fraax-eliox-praael-kelion-quenvan-kasox-rusael-norius-belvan

**Q: How is the Northpane profile store sharded?**

Profiles are hash-sharded on user ID across 64 logical shards, mapped to physical nodes via a routing table in `shardmap.json`. Resharding is handled by the Relocator job; reviewers should verify that any new query paths go through the router rather than hitting shards directly. Cross-shard joins are not supported by design. Questions about shard placement or migration windows go to the address below.

escalation mailbox, tagef-hafog: oliox@paliqworks.internal

Handover — Vexler partner SFTP drop

Ownership moves to you today. Drop runs hourly from Vexler's end into the intake bucket via the relay host. Watch for zero-byte files; their exporter flakes on Mondays. Creds live in the ops vault, path noted in the runbook. Vault auto-seals after 48h idle. Support escalations go to the on-call rotation, not me. If the vault is sealed when you need it, unseal with the recovery passphrase below.

recovery phrase for tadug-fafof: zorwyn-kasion

## Releases

Hey support folks — quick notes on ProfileMesh shard releases. Each release re-balances user-profile shards gradually, so don't panic if a lookup lands on a stale shard for a few minutes post-deploy; it self-heals. Release bundles are published twice a month and are always signed. If a customer asks you to verify a bundle they downloaded, walk them through the checksum step using the public signing key below.

deploy key for kawif-bageg: bky19_YQNdHDgpaLxUNwPoHm9